About this role

What You'll Do



As a Claim Analyst 2 on our Specialty Product Team, you'll have the opportunity to review, analyze, and make appropriate and accurate decisions on Accident, Critical Illness, Health Screenings and Hospital Indemnity claims in accordance with the policy and state/federal laws and regulations.  This is a fast-paced environment where everyday offers change all while assisting our customers who may be facing major changes in life. 

 

Here are a few examples of the kinds of things you'll do:

  • Analyze and adjudicate Specialty Product claims after determining and obtaining all appropriate claim requirements. Analyze enrollment, medical, and vocational information to make effective and timely claim decisions. Maintain fully documented claim file providing a clear and understandable audit trail required for compliance and legal purposes.
  • Identify and refer claims with recommendation for appropriate action to other resources (senior claims personnel, Medical, Law, etc).
  • Communicate with claimants, employers, and medical providers regarding claim  decisions, status, and all other aspects of the claim process in writing or verbally.

  • Prepare claim payments based on appropriate interpretation and administration of multiple different contracts and contract provisions.

  • Perform other job-related duties and special projects as required.

Who You Are



  • 4+ years of claims or customer service experience or equivalent demonstrated through one or a combination of the following: work experience, training, military experience, education.
  • Medical and/or legal terminology and prior Life and Disability or Specialty Product claims experience preferred.
  • Ability to maintain a high degree of accuracy and pay strict attention to detail.
  • Must be able to work in a team environment.
  • Good analytical, organizational, problem solving and decision-making skills.
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ality.
  • Good verbal and written communication skills (must be able to communicate with individuals experiencing illnesses, financial losses, or deaths of loved ones as well as legal and/or medical professionals).
  • Good math skills.
  • Ability to maintain good public relations with customers (employers, employees).
